Sep 1, 2026 - Hawaii has received $58 million in federal funding through the Rural Health Transformation Program to improve access to healthcare and strengthen services in rural and underserved communities. This includes $45 million for the University of Hawaii School of Medicine to administer workforce development programs and $13 million for the Hawaii Department of Health to acquire new ambulances and upgrade emergency communications systems.

Aug 28, 2026 - Various Virginia community-based organizations are among the first wave of grantees who will use Rural Health Transformation Fund (RHTF) money to hire and retain rural healthcare providers, invest in healthcare technologies, and strengthen the healthcare workforce in rural areas. Virginia received a total $189 million in RHTF money late last year.

Aug 27, 2026 - Highlights Rural Health Transformation Program (RHTP) funding in Ohio to connect pharmacies, Federally Qualified Health Centers, health systems, and other partners across the state through a health information exchange. The goal is to build a rural pharmacy network, expand clinical services in pharmacies, and conduct a pharmacy needs assessment across the state.

Aug 27, 2026 - Arkansas Governor Sarah Huckabee Sanders announced Rural Health Transformation Program (RHTP) funding of $55.7 million through the Telehealth, Health-Monitoring, and Response Innovation for Vital Expansion initiative and $93.6 million through the Promoting Access Coordination and Transformation priority. Arkansas is expected to receive approximately $1 billion in RHTP funding in the next five years.
